  • Edit the Windows Live Writer Custom Dictionary

    - by Matthew Guay
    Windows Live Writer is a great tool for writing and publishing posts to your blog, but its spell check unfortunately doesn’t include many common tech words.  Here’s how you can easily edit your custom dictionary and add your favorite words. Customize Live Writer’s Dictionary Adding an individual word to the Windows Live Writer dictionary works as you would expect.  Right-click on a word and select Add to dictionary. And changing the default spell check settings is easy too.  In the menu, click Tools, then Options, and select the Spelling tab in this dialog.  Here you can choose your dictionary language and turn on/off real-time spell checking and other settings. But there’s no obvious way to edit your custom dictionary.  Editing the custom dictionary directly is nice if you accidently add a misspelled word to your dictionary and want to remove it, or if you want to add a lot of words to the dictionary at once. Live Writer actually stores your custom dictionary entries in a plain text file located in your appdata folder.  It is saved as User.dic in the C:\Users\user_name\AppData\Roaming\Windows Live Writer\Dictionaries folder.  The easiest way to open the custom dictionary is to enter the following in the Run box or the address bar of an Explorer window: %appdata%\Windows Live Writer\Dictionaries\User.dic   This will open the User.dic file in your default text editor.  Add any new words to the custom dictionary on separate lines, and delete any misspelled words you accidently added to the dictionary.   Microsoft Office Word also stores its custom dictionary in a plain text file.  If you already have lots of custom words in it and want to import them into Live Writer, enter the following in the Run command or Explorer’s address bar to open Word’s custom dictionary.  Then copy the words, and past them into your Live Writer custom dictionary file. %AppData%\Microsoft\UProof\Custom.dic Don’t forget to save the changes when you’re done.  Note that the changes to the dictionary may not show up in Live Writer’s spell check until you restart the program.  If it’s currently running, save any posts you’re working on, exit, and then reopen, and all of your new words should be in the dictionary. Conclusion Whether you use Live Writer daily in your job or occasionally post an update to a personal blog, adding your own custom words to the dictionary can save you a lot of time and frustration in editing.  Plus, if you’ve accidently added a misspelled word to the dictionary, this is a great way to undo your mistake and make sure your spelling is up to par!   • Tip on Reusing Classes in Different .NET Project Types

    - by psheriff
    All of us have class libraries that we developed for use in our projects. When you create a .NET Class Library project with many classes, you can use that DLL in ASP.NET, Windows Forms and WPF applications. However, for Silverlight and Windows Phone, these .NET Class Libraries cannot be used. The reason is Silverlight and Windows Phone both use a scaled down version of .NET and thus do not have access to the full .NET framework class library. However, there are many classes and functionality that will work in the full .NET and in the scaled down versions that Silverlight and Windows Phone use.Let’s take an example of a class that you might want to use in all of the above mentioned projects. The code listing shown below might be something that you have in a Windows Form or an ASP.NET application. public class StringCommon{  public static bool IsAllLowerCase(string value)  {    return new Regex(@"^([^A-Z])+$").IsMatch(value);  }   public static bool IsAllUpperCase(string value)  {    return new Regex(@"^([^a-z])+$").IsMatch(value);  }} The StringCommon class is very simple with just two methods, but you know that the System.Text.RegularExpressions namespace is available in Silverlight and Windows Phone. Thus, you know that you may reuse this class in your Silverlight and Windows Phone projects. Here is the problem: if you create a Silverlight Class Library project and you right-click on that project in Solution Explorer and choose Add | Add Existing Item… from the menu, the class file StringCommon.cs will be copied from the original location and placed into the Silverlight Class Library project. You now have two files with the same code. If you want to change the code you will now need to change it in two places! This is a maintenance nightmare that you have just created. If you then add this to a Windows Phone Class Library project, you now have three places you need to modify the code! Add As LinkInstead of creating three separate copies of the same class file, you want to leave the original class file in its original location and just create a link to that file from the Silverlight and Windows Phone class libraries. Visual Studio will allow you to do this, but you need to do one additional step in the Add Existing Item dialog (see Figure 1). You will still right mouse click on the project and choose Add | Add Existing Item… from the menu. You will still highlight the file you want to add to your project, but DO NOT click on the Add button. Instead click on the drop down portion of the Add button and choose the “Add As Link” menu item. This will now create a link to the file on disk and will not copy the file into your new project. Figure 1: Add as Link will create a link, not copy the file over. When this linked file is added to your project, there will be a different icon next to that file in the Solution Explorer window. This icon signifies that this is a link to a file in another folder on your hard drive.   Figure 2: The Linked file will have a different icon to show it is a link. Of course, if you have code that will not work in Silverlight or Windows Phone -- because the code has dependencies on features of .NET that are not supported on those platforms – you  can always wrap conditional compilation code around the offending code so it will be removed when compiled in those class libraries. SummaryIn this short blog entry you learned how to reuse one of your class libraries from ASP.NET, Windows Forms or WPF applications in your Silverlight or Windows Phone class libraries. You can do this without creating a maintenance nightmare by using the “Add a Link” feature of the Add Existing Item dialog.   • Code Contracts: validating arrays and collections

    - by DigiMortal
    Validating collections before using them is very common task when we use built-in generic types for our collections. In this posting I will show you how to validate collections using code contracts. It is cool how much awful looking code you can avoid using code contracts. Failing code Let’s suppose we have method that calculates sum of all invoices in collection. We have class Invoice and one of properties it has is Sum. I don’t introduce here any complex calculations on invoices because we have another problem to solve in this topic. Here is our code. public static decimal CalculateTotal(IList<Invoice> invoices) {     var sum = invoices.Sum(p => p.Sum);     return sum; } This method is very simple but it fails when invoices list contains at least one null. Of course, we can test if invoice is null but having nulls in lists like this is not good idea – it opens green way for different coding bugs in system. Our goal is to react to bugs ASAP at the nearest place they occur. There is one more way how to make our method fail. It happens when invoices is null. I thing it is also one common bugs during development and it even happens in production environments under some conditions that are usually hardly met. Now let’s protect our little calculation method with code contracts. We need two contracts: invoices cannot be null invoices cannot contain any nulls Our first contract is easy but how to write the second one? Solution: Contract.ForAll Preconditions in code are checked using Contract.Ensures method. This method takes boolean value as argument that sais if contract holds or not. There is also method Contract.ForAll that takes collection and predicate that must hold for that collection. Nice thing is ForAll returns boolean. So, we have very simple solution. public static decimal CalculateTotal(IList<Invoice> invoices) {     Contract.Requires(invoices != null);     Contract.Requires(Contract.ForAll<Invoice>(invoices, p => p != null));       var sum = invoices.Sum(p => p.Sum);     return sum; } And here are some lines of code you can use to test the contracts quickly. var invoices = new List<Invoice>(); invoices.Add(new Invoice()); invoices.Add(null); invoices.Add(new Invoice()); //CalculateTotal(null); CalculateTotal(invoices); If your code is covered with unit tests then I suggest you to write tests to check that these contracts hold for every code run. Conclusion Although it seemed at first place that checking all elements in collection may end up with for-loops that does not look so nice we were able to solve our problem nicely. ForAll method of contract class offered us simple mechanism to check collections and it does it smoothly the code-contracts-way. P.S.   • Prefilling an SMS on Mobile Devices with the sms: Uri Scheme

    - by Rick Strahl
    Popping up the native SMS app from a mobile HTML Web page is a nice feature that allows you to pre-fill info into a text for sending by a user of your mobile site. The syntax is a bit tricky due to some device inconsistencies (and quite a bit of wrong/incomplete info on the Web), but it's definitely something that's fairly easy to do.In one of my Mobile HTML Web apps I need to share a current location via SMS. While browsing around a page I want to select a geo location, then share it by texting it to somebody. Basically I want to pre-fill an SMS message with some text, but no name or number, which instead will be filled in by the user.What worksThe syntax that seems to work fairly consistently except for iOS is this:sms:phonenumber?body=messageFor iOS instead of the ? use a ';' (because Apple is always right, standards be damned, right?):sms:phonenumber;body=messageand that works to pop up a new SMS message on the mobile device. I've only marginally tested this with a few devices: an iPhone running iOS 6, an iPad running iOS 7, Windows Phone 8 and a Nexus S in the Android Emulator. All four devices managed to pop up the SMS with the data prefilled.You can use this in a link:<a href="sms:1-111-1111;body=I made it!">Send location via SMS</a>or you can set it on the window.location in JavaScript:window.location ="sms:1-111-1111;body=" + encodeURIComponent("I made it!");to make the window pop up directly from code. Notice that the content should be URL encoded - HTML links automatically encode, but when you assign the URL directly in code the text value should be encoded.Body onlyI suspect in most applications you won't know who to text, so you only want to fill the text body, not the number. That works as you'd expect by just leaving out the number - here's what the URLs look like in that case:sms:?body=messageFor iOS same thing except with the ;sms:;body=messageHere's an example of the code I use to set up the SMS:var ua = navigator.userAgent.toLowerCase(); var url; if (ua.indexOf("iphone") > -1 || ua.indexOf("ipad") > -1) url = "sms:;body=" + encodeURIComponent("I'm at " + mapUrl + " @ " + pos.Address); else url = "sms:?body=" + encodeURIComponent("I'm at " + mapUrl + " @ " + pos.Address); location.href = url;and that also works for all the devices mentioned above.It's pretty cool that URL schemes exist to access device functionality and the SMS one will come in pretty handy for a number of things.   • Master Data Management for Location Data - Oracle Site Hub

    - by david.butler(at)oracle.com
    Most MDM discussions cover key domains such as customer, supplier, product, service, and reference data. It is usually understood that these domains have complex structures and hundreds if not thousands of attributes that need governing. Location, on the other hand, strikes most people as address data. How hard can that be? But for many industries, locations are complex, and site information is critical to efficient operations and relevant analytics. Retail stores and malls, bank branches, construction sites come to mind. But one of the best industries for illustrating the power of a site mastering application is Oil & Gas.   Oracle's Master Data Management solution for location data is the Oracle Site Hub. It is a location mastering solution that enables organizations to centralize site and location specific information from heterogeneous systems, creating a single view of site information that can be leveraged across all functional departments and analytical systems.   Let's take a look at the location entities the Oracle Site Hub can manage for the Oil & Gas industry: organizations, property, land, buildings, roads, oilfield, service center, inventory site, real estate, facilities, refineries, storage tanks, vendor locations, businesses, assets; project site, area, well, basin, pipelines, critical infrastructure, offshore platform, compressor station, gas station, etc. Any site can be classified into multiple hierarchies, like organizational hierarchy, operational hierarchy, geographic hierarchy, divisional hierarchies and so on. Any site can also be associated to multiple clusters, i.e. collections of sites, and these can be used as a foundation for driving reporting, analysis, organize daily work, etc. Hierarchies can also be used to model entities which are structured or non-structured collections of nodes, like for example routes, pipelines and more. The User Defined Attribute Framework provides the needed infrastructure to add single row attributes groups like well base attributes (well IDs, well type, well structure and key characterizing measures, and more) and well geometry, and multi row attribute groups like well applications, permits, production data, activities, operations, logs, treatments, tests, drills, treatments, and KPIs. Site Hub can also model areas, lands, fields, basins, pools, platforms, eco-zones, and stratigraphic layers as specific sites, tracking their base attributes, aliases, descriptions, subcomponents and more. Midstream entities (pipelines, logistic sites, pump stations) and downstream entities (cylinders, tanks, inventories, meters, partner's sites, routes, facilities, gas stations, and competitor sites) can also be easily modeled, together with their specific attributes and relationships. Site Hub can store any type of unstructured data associated to a site. This could be stored directly or on an external content management solution, like Oracle Universal Content Management. Considering a well, for example, Site Hub can store any relevant associated multimedia file such as: CAD drawings of the well profile, structure and/or parts, engineering documents, contracts, applications, permits, logs, pictures, photos, videos and more. For any site entity, Site Hub can associate all the related assets and equipments at the site, as well as all relationships between sites, between a site and multiple parties, and between a site and any purchasable or sellable item, over time. Items can be equipment, instruments, facilities, services, products, production entities, production facilities (pipelines, batteries, compressor stations, gas plants, meters, separators, etc.), support facilities (rigs, roads, transmission or radio towers, airstrips, etc.), supplier products and services, catalogs, and more. Items can just be associated to sites using standard Site Hub features, or they can be fully mastered by implementing Oracle Product Hub. Site locations (addresses or geographical coordinates) are also managed with out-of-the-box address geo-coding capabilities coupled with Google Maps integration to deliver powerful mapping capabilities and spatial data analysis. Locations can be shared between different sites. Centered on the site location, any site can also have associated areas. Site Hub can master any site location specific information, like for example cadastral, ownership, jurisdictional, geological, seismic and more, and any site-centric area specific information, like for example economical, political, risk, weather, logistic, traffic information and more. Now if anyone ever asks you why locations need MDM, think about how all these Oil & Gas entities and attributes would translate into your business locations.   • Restrict number of characters to be typed for af:autoSuggestBehavior

    - by Arunkumar Ramamoorthy
    When using AutoSuggestBehavior for a UI Component, the auto suggest list is displayed as soon as the user starts typing in the field. In this article, we will find how to restrict the autosuggest list to be displayed till the user types in couple of characters. This would be more useful in the low latency networks and also the autosuggest list is bigger. We could display a static message to let the user know that they need to type in more characters to get a list for picking a value from. Final output we would expect is like the below image Lets see how we can implement this. Assuming we have an input text for the users to enter the country name and an autosuggest behavior is added to it. <af:inputText label="Country" id="it1"> <af:autoSuggestBehavior /> </af:inputText> Also, assuming we have a VO (we'll name it as CountryView for this example), with a view criteria to filter out the VO based on the bind variable passed. Now, we would generate View Impl class from the java node (including bind variables) and then expose the setter method of the bind variable to client interface. In the View layer, we would create a tree binding for the VO and the method binding for the setter method of the bind variable exposed above, in the pagedef file As we've already added an input text and an autosuggestbehavior for the test, we would not need to build the suggested items for the autosuggest list.Let us add a method in the backing bean to return us List of select items to be bound to the autosuggest list. padding: 5px; background-color: #fbfbfb; min-height: 40px; width: 544px; height: 168px; overflow: auto;"> public List onSuggest(String searchTerm) { ArrayList<SelectItem> selectItems = new ArrayList<SelectItem>(); if(searchTerm.length()>1) { //get access to the binding context and binding container at runtime BindingContext bctx = BindingContext.getCurrent(); BindingContainer bindings = bctx.getCurrentBindingsEntry(); //set the bind variable value that is used to filter the View Object //query of the suggest list. The View Object instance has a View //Criteria assigned OperationBinding setVariable = (OperationBinding) bindings.get("setBind_CountryName"); setVariable.getParamsMap().put("value", searchTerm); setVariable.execute(); //the data in the suggest list is queried by a tree binding. JUCtrlHierBinding hierBinding = (JUCtrlHierBinding) bindings.get("CountryView1"); //re-query the list based on the new bind variable values hierBinding.executeQuery(); //The rangeSet, the list of queries entries, is of type //JUCtrlValueBndingRef. List<JUCtrlValueBindingRef> displayDataList = hierBinding.getRangeSet(); for (JUCtrlValueBindingRef displayData : displayDataList){ Row rw = displayData.getRow(); //populate the SelectItem list selectItems.add(new SelectItem( (String)rw.getAttribute("Name"), (String)rw.getAttribute("Name"))); } } else{ SelectItem a = new SelectItem("","Type in two or more characters..","",true); selectItems.add(a); } return selectItems; } So, what we are doing in the above method is, to check the length of the search term and if it is more than 1 (i.e 2 or more characters), the return the actual suggest list. Otherwise, create a read only select item new SelectItem("","Type in two or more characters..","",true); and add it to the list of suggested items to be displayed. The last parameter for the SelectItem (boolean) is to make it as readOnly, so that users would not be able to select this static message from the displayed list. Finally, bind this method to the input text's autosuggestbehavior's suggestedItems property. <af:inputText label="Country" id="it1"> <af:autoSuggestBehavior suggestedItems="#{AutoSuggestBean.onSuggest}"/> </af:inputText>

  • PECL OCI8 2.0 Production Release Announcement

    - by cj
    The PHP OCI8 2.0.6 extension for Oracle Database is now "production" status. The source code is available on PECL. This can be used immediately to update your OCI8 extension in PHP 5.2 and later versions. The extension compiles with Oracle 10.2 or later client libraries. Oracle's standard cross-version database connectivity applies. OCI8 2.0 and PHP 5.5.5 RPMs for Oracle and Red Hat Linux are available from oss.oracle.com. Windows DLLs are available on PECL for PHP 5.3, PHP 5.4 and PHP 5.5. OCI8 2.0 source code will also be automatically included in the next major version of PHP. New Functionality Oracle Database 12c Implicit Result Set support. IRS's make it easy to pass query results back from stored PL/SQL procedures or anonymous PL/SQL blocks. Individual IRS statement resources, each corresponding to a single query, can be obtained with the new function oci_get_implicit_resultset(). These 'child' statement resources can be passed to any oci_fetch_* function. See Using PHP and Oracle Database 12c Implicit Result Sets and the PHP Manual: oci_get_implicit_resultset(). DTrace Dynamic Trace static probes. This well respected DTrace tracing framework is available on a number of platforms, including Oracle Linux. PHP OCI8 static user-space probes can be enabled with PHP's --enable-dtrace configuration option. See Using PHP DTrace on Oracle Linux. Documentation is also available in the PHP Manual OCI8 and DTrace Dynamic Tracing Improved Functionality Using oci_execute($s, OCI_NO_AUTO_COMMIT) for a SELECT no longer unnecessarily initiates an internal ROLLBACK during connection close. This can improve overall scalability by reducing "round trips" between PHP and the database. Changed Functionality PHP OCI8 2.0's minimum pre-requisites are now PHP 5.2 and Oracle client library 10.2. Later versions of both are usable and, in fact, recommended. Use the older PHP OCI8 1.4.10 extension when using PHP 4.3.9 through to PHP 5.1.x, or when only Oracle Database 9.2 client libraries are available. oci_set_*($connection, ...) meta data setting call error handling is fixed so that oci_error($connection) works for these calls. Note: The old, deprecated function aliases like ocilogon still exist but are not recommended for new applications. Phpinfo() Changes Some cosmetic changes were made to the output of php --ri oci8 and the phpinfo() function. The oci8.event and oci8.connection_class values are now shown only when the Oracle client libraries support the respective functionality. Connection statistics are now in a separate phpinfo() table. Temporary LOB and Collection support status lines in phpinfo() output were removed. These two features have always been enabled since 2007. Oci_internal_debug() Changes The oci_internal_debug() function is now a no-op. Use PHP's --enable-dtrace functionality with DTrace or SystemTap instead.   • How the SPARC T4 Processor Optimizes Throughput Capacity: A Case Study

    - by Ruud
    This white paper demonstrates the architected latency hiding features of Oracle’s UltraSPARC T2+ and SPARC T4 processors That is the first sentence from this technical white paper, but what does it exactly mean? Let's consider a very simple example, the computation of a = b + c. This boils down to the following (pseudo-assembler) instructions that need to be executed: load @b, r1 load @c, r2 add r1,r2,r3 store r3, @a The first two instructions load variables b and c from an address in memory (here symbolized by @b and @c respectively). These values go into registers r1 and r2. The third instruction adds the values in r1 and r2. The result goes into register r3. The fourth instruction stores the contents of r3 into the memory address symbolized by @a. If we're lucky, both b and c are in a nearby cache and the load instructions only take a few processor cycles to execute. That is the good case, but what if b or c, or both, have to come from very far away? Perhaps both of them are in the main memory and then it easily takes hundreds of cycles for the values to arrive in the registers. Meanwhile the processor is doing nothing and simply waits for the data to arrive. Actually, it does something. It burns cycles while waiting. That is a waste of time and energy. Why not use these cycles to execute instructions from another application or thread in case of a parallel program? That is exactly what latency hiding on the SPARC T-Series processors does. It is a hardware feature totally transparent to the user and application. As soon as there is a delay in the execution, the hardware uses these otherwise idle cycles to execute instructions from another process. As a result, the throughput capacity of the system improves because idle cycles are no longer wasted and therefore more jobs can be run per unit of time. This feature has been in the SPARC T-series from the beginning, so why this paper? The difference with previous publications on this topic is in the amount of detail given. How this all works under the hood is fully explained using two example programs. Starting from the assembly language instructions, it is demonstrated in what way these programs execute. To really see what is happening we go down to the processor pipeline level, where the gaps in the execution are, and show in what way these idle cycles are filled by other copies of the same program running simultaneously. Both the SPARC T4 as well as the older UltraSPARC T2+ processor are covered. You may wonder why the UltraSPARC T2+ is included. The focus of this work is on the SPARC T4 processor, but to explain the basic concept of latency hiding at this very low level, we start with the UltraSPARC T2+ processor because it is architecturally a much simpler design. From the single issue, in-order pipelines of this processor we then shift gears and cover how this all works on the much more advanced dual issue, out-of-order architecture of the T4. The analysis and performance experiments have been conducted on both processors. The results depend on the processor, but in all cases the theoretical estimates are confirmed by the experiments. If you're interested to read a lot more about this and find out how things really work under the hood, you can download a copy of the paper here.
